Maxey, Betty G.

Maxey, Betty G, (nee Stroupe) Friday February 5, 2021. Beloved wife of the late Stuart M. Maxey and Albert A. Lonati. Dear mother of Linda (Jerry) Lonati-Lagle, Carla (Mike) Qualls, Susan (Robert) Leiber and Laura Lonati. Dear grandmother of Kathy (Evan), Jason (Jenny), Jennifer, Michael, Nicholas, Melissa (Don), Amy. Malinda (Brian), Martin (Angel) and Jaime, Jerry, Angela (Jim), Steven. Dear great grandmother of Madison, Kelsey, Kyle, Michael, Megan, Ellie, Michael, Carter, Nathan, Emily, Kaitlyn, Maci, Kimbry, Myles, Alexis, Caitlin,Jonathon, Eliana, Shintaro and Seina. Dear great great grandmother of Tommy “T.J.” and Harrison.  Our dear sister, sister-in-law, aunt, great aunt, cousin and friend.

A memorial Mass will be held Friday February 19, 10:00 am at St. Margaret Mary Alacoque Catholic Church.  Interment Jefferson Barracks National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, Betty would appreciate you planting a tree in your yard in her memory, or contributions to the charity of your choice. Kutis South County service.
